For Ages 3-5:

The Little Christmas Tree by Loek Koopmans

Join a charming little Christmas tree on its journey to find a home. As it encounters various animals and people, the tree discovers the true meaning of the season. This delightful story introduces young readers to the concept of kindness, friendship, and the joy of giving. The vibrant illustrations and simple narrative make it a perfect pick for cozy December evenings.

Suggested Family Activity: Gather around the fireplace or a festive setting and create your own little Christmas tree craft. Use colorful paper, glitter, and other decorations to make it uniquely yours. Share stories about your favorite holiday traditions as you craft together.


For Ages 6-8:

The Polar Express by Chris Van Allsburg

Embark on a magical train journey to the North Pole on Christmas Eve. A young boy experiences the wonder of the season and learns the power of belief. It captures the enchantment of Christmas through beautiful illustrations and a timeless tale of wonder and belief. It's a heartwarming story that resonates with readers of all ages.

Suggested Family Activity: Host a cozy pajama night and have a family movie night featuring "The Polar Express." Create a DIY hot chocolate bar and enjoy the film together. Discuss the importance of belief, kindness, and the joy of the holiday season.


For Ages 9-11:

Winterfrost by Michelle Houts

Discover the magic of a Danish Christmas as a young girl, Bettina, embarks on an adventure to save Christmas when a mischievous nisse (Christmas elf) steals her family's Christmas pudding. Winterfrost blends folklore and heartwarming storytelling to create a tale of courage, family, and the enchantment of Christmas. The winter setting and cultural elements add a unique flavor to the narrative.

Suggested Family Activity: Bake a traditional Danish Christmas treat together. Whether it's æbleskiver or a festive pastry, involve the whole family in the kitchen. As you enjoy your delicious creation, discuss the importance of family traditions and the magic of the holiday season.
